Mrs S Deol v Sonic Laboratories Ltd (England and Wales : Maternity and Pregnancy Rights : Race Discrimination : Sex Discrimination : Unfair Dismissal) [2017] UKET 3323774/2016 (28 February 2017)

Mrs S Deol v Sonic Laboratories Ltd (England and Wales : Maternity and Pregnancy Rights : Race Discrimination : Sex Discrimination : Unfair Dismissal) [2017] UKET 3323774/2016 (28 February 2017)

The Tribunal found that the claimant was unfairly dismissed and discriminated against on grounds of pregnancy, maternity, race, and sex, as the respondent failed to provide credible non-discriminatory reasons for dismissal.
